The COPD Score in 02561, Sagamore, Massachusetts is 97 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

100.00 percent of the population in 02561 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 55.56 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 18.22 percent of the residents in 02561 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.82 members with about 2.14 cars available per household.

An estimate of 97.66 percent of the residents in 02561 has some form of health insurance. 36.78 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 64.98 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 02561 would have to travel an average of 14.95 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Falmouth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 02561, Sagamore, Massachusetts.

First, let's explore what COPD is and why access to healthcare is vital for those living with this condition. COPD is a chronic inflammatory lung disease that causes obstructed airflow from the lungs. Symptoms include breathing difficulty, cough, mucus production, and wheezing. The condition can significantly impact an individual's quality of life and requires ongoing management and treatment from healthcare professionals. Missing a provider's appointment can have serious consequences for someone with COPD, including exacerbation of symptoms, increased risk of complications, and potential hospitalization. Therefore, easy access to healthcare services is paramount for individuals with COPD in maintaining their health and well-being.

Understanding the historical context of Sagamore can provide insights into how the community has evolved and shaped its approach to healthcare over time. Sagamore is a village within the town of Bourne in Barnstable County, Massachusetts. Its location along the Cape Cod Canal has contributed to its significance as a transportation hub historically. Today, Sagamore retains its small-town charm while being in close proximity to essential amenities such as healthcare facilities.
